Expert Review

Joining DHL as a Material Handler means stepping into a crucial role within the logistics sector. This position involves loading and unloading materials, operating essential machinery like forklifts, and ensuring efficient storage of products. It’s a physically demanding job that requires stamina and attention to safety protocols.

The role is well-suited for those who thrive in fast-paced settings and prefer active work. While the job offers a chance to gain valuable skills in warehouse operations, it can also entail long hours, especially during peak delivery seasons. This aspect may deter those looking for more traditional 9-5 roles.

DHL’s reputation as a global leader in logistics provides a solid foundation for career advancement. Employees often find opportunities to move up within the company, particularly in roles related to logistics management. However, potential candidates should note that specific salary details are not publicly listed, which can be a concern for those seeking clear compensation expectations.
